Easy hiking trails around Afritz am See are set within the picturesque Gegendtal valley, characterized by the rolling hills of the Nockberge mountains. The region features the idyllic Afritzer See and Brennsee, offering accessible lakeside paths and views of the glittering water. Verditz, located above Afritzer See, provides mountain landscapes ideal for hiking. This diverse terrain, ranging from lake shores to gentle hills, creates a mild climate suitable for outdoor activities.

The lake is located in the valley in the Nockberge at an altitude of 752 m above sea level. A. between the Wöllaner Nock and the Mirnock. It is located on the southern edge of the municipality of Feld am See; the municipal border with Afritz partly follows the shoreline. The southeast bank is largely untouched. Millstätter Straße (B 98) runs along the northeast bank. The lake is the remnant of a once larger lake. This was divided by a rockslide from the Mirnock (Lierzberger Alpenspitz – Wieserwald): into the Afritzer See and the Feldsee. The two lakes are separated by a shallow valley watershed. The Afritzsee drains to the southeast towards Treffen. The lake is fed by a few small streams that have created alluvial fans, particularly on the south and west banks. Since the lake lies in a valley valley that is often windy, it does not reach the high water temperatures of other Carinthian lakes. However, it is strictly layered in summer.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many easy hiking trails are available around Afritz am See?

Afritz am See offers a wide selection of easy hiking trails, with nearly 200 routes suitable for relaxed walks. These trails are set amidst the picturesque Gegendtal valley, featuring serene lake paths and gentle rolling hills.

What are some popular easy circular walks around Afritz am See?

For a pleasant circular experience, consider the Lake Afritz – Lakeside Path at Lake Afritz loop from Afritzer See, an easy 4.2 km path offering scenic views. Another option is the View of Lake Afritz – View of Lake Afritz loop from Afritzer See, which is 4.4 km long and provides lovely lake vistas.

Are there any easy trails that feature waterfalls?

Yes, you can explore trails that lead to beautiful waterfalls. The Afritz Waterfall – View of Lake Afritz loop from Afritz am See is a 6.7 km trail that takes you through varied terrain with views of the lake and the Afritz Waterfall. Another shorter option is the Gasthof Pension Lindner – Afritz Waterfall loop from Afritz am See, a 3 km route.

What is the best time of year for easy hikes in Afritz am See?

The best seasons for hiking in Afritz am See are spring and autumn. During these times, the climate is mild, and the landscape is particularly beautiful, with vibrant spring blooms or stunning autumn foliage. The region's location south of the Hohe Tauern contributes to a mild climate suitable for outdoor activities throughout much of the year.

Are there family-friendly hiking options in the area?

Absolutely. The region is known for its family-friendly trails. The Afritzer See Slow Trail is a gentle 4.6 km hike through a species-rich nature reserve, perfect for a relaxed family outing. Additionally, the 'Bergwelt' nature trail mentioned in the region research offers an educational and adventurous experience for children, teaching them about local flora, fauna, and geology.

Can I bring my dog on the easy hiking trails?

Many easy hiking trails around Afritz am See are dog-friendly, especially the lakeside paths and forest trails. It's always recommended to keep your dog on a leash, particularly in nature reserve areas or when encountering wildlife. Please check specific trail regulations if you plan to visit a designated nature protection zone.

What kind of natural features or viewpoints can I expect on these easy trails?

Easy trails in Afritz am See often feature stunning natural beauty. You can expect picturesque views of the Afritzer See and Brennsee (Feldsee), surrounded by the gentle, rolling hills of the Nockberge mountains. Many routes offer accessible lakeside paths and opportunities to enjoy green alpine meadows. For panoramic views, while not an easy hike itself, the Gerlitzen Summit is a prominent nearby viewpoint that can be accessed by other means.

Are there any places to eat or rest along the easy hiking routes?

Yes, some hiking routes in the broader Afritz am See area offer opportunities to experience local alpine culture with huts and alpine pastures. For example, hikes like the one to the Trangoin hut or the Feldpannalm round provide places for a rest and refreshments. For specific amenities on easy trails, it's best to check individual route descriptions on komoot.

What do other hikers say about the easy trails in Afritz am See?

The easy hiking trails in Afritz am See are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 stars from over 3,600 reviews. Hikers often praise the serene lake paths, the beautiful natural scenery of the Gegendtal valley, and the well-maintained routes that make for an enjoyable and accessible outdoor experience.

Are there any historical or themed trails for easy walks?

Yes, the region offers unique themed trails. The 'Weg des Buches' (Path of the Book) is a Protestant theme route that delves into the region's history of Bible smugglers and secret Protestants, offering a cultural dimension to your walk. While sections of the long-distance Alpe-Adria Trail can be explored from Afritz am See, some parts may be more challenging than 'easy' walks.

What is the typical duration for an easy hike around Afritz am See?

The duration for easy hikes varies, but many popular routes are designed for shorter, more relaxed experiences. For instance, the Afritzer See Slow Trail typically takes about 1 hour and 14 minutes to complete, while the Lake Afritz – Lakeside Path at Lake Afritz loop is usually finished in around 1 hour and 11 minutes. Longer easy routes, like the Afritz Waterfall – View of Lake Afritz loop, can take closer to 1 hour and 49 minutes.

Are there any other notable attractions near the easy hiking trails?

Beyond the trails themselves, the area around Afritz am See offers several points of interest. You can visit the Annenheim Lakefront Promenade on Lake Ossiach for another beautiful lakeside experience, or explore the Finsterbach Waterfalls, which are part of a larger gorge system. The Töplitsch-Puch cycle bridge is also a unique structure nearby.
